Hanoi's Industrial Leap: Northern Vietnam's Advanced Electronics Axis

The Hanoi metropolitan area—alongside its adjacent industrial corridors in Bac Ninh, Thai Nguyen, and Vinh Phuc—has emerged as a global powerhouse for high-tech electronics manufacturing and smart hardware assembly. As multinational manufacturers and home-grown technology firms rapidly scale up production of IoT systems, smart home interfaces, medical equipment, and automotive sub-systems, the demand for high-reliability, micro-sized motion components has reached unprecedented heights.

Within this ecosystem, the DC micro vibration motor serves as a core technology component, delivering structural feedback signals, tactile responses, and small-amplitude oscillations essential for user-interface interactions. DyneticPro provides Hanoi's electronics factories with direct access to high-performance vibration motors, bypassing redundant distribution layers to ensure stable pricing, custom engineering adaptions, and resilient logistics.

China-Vietnam Supply Chain Synergy: Seamless Cross-Border Logistics to Hanoi

For modern hardware manufacturers in Hanoi, supply chain velocity is a competitive differentiator. Relocating final assembly lines to Vietnam does not mean abandoning the highly optimized component ecosystem of China. DyneticPro bridges this geographical transition by capitalizing on high-speed land transport corridors connecting our production centers in China directly to Hanoi.

By leveraging the Nanning-Hanoi economic transit route via the Pingxiang/Dong Dang border gate, raw materials and custom-fabricated motor batches can arrive at your factory floor in Bac Ninh or Hanoi within 48 to 72 hours of customs clearance. This logistical agility allows local factories to operate with leaner buffer stocks, reducing capital lock-up while ensuring rapid adaptation to design alterations.

Environmental Compliance

All micro vibration motor series conform to RoHS Directive 2011/65/EU and REACH standards. We eliminate hazardous substances like lead, cadmium, and polybrominated biphenyls from our winding and soldering pipelines, preventing environmental bottlenecks for exporters selling to European and North American markets.

System Level Quality Control

Our manufacturing sites run under strict ISO 9001:2015 and IATF 16949 quality system frameworks. Every single step—from dynamic balancing of the eccentric mass to testing coil winding resistance—is tracked digitally to provide comprehensive traceability.

Engineering Support in Hanoi

We provide localized layout reviews, CAD model generation, and sample evaluation packages. Our engineering team assists you in selecting the ideal eccentric weight mass, mounting configuration, and spring contact terminals to match your PCB footprint.

Industrial Q&A: Core Technical Insights on DC Micro Vibration Motors

Addressing essential engineering queries for procurement managers and mechanical designers.

Q1: What are the differences between ERM (Eccentric Rotating Mass) and LRA (Linear Resonant Actuator) vibration motors?
ERM motors use an offset weight mounted on the rotating shaft of a DC motor. The rotation of this weight creates centrifugal force, generating vibration in two axes perpendicular to the shaft. They are simple to drive using standard DC voltage. LRAs, by contrast, utilize a moving mass suspended by springs, oscillating linearly in response to an AC drive signal. LRAs offer faster response times and localized haptic effects, but require specialized driver ICs, whereas ERMs remain the most cost-effective and straightforward vibration solution for general-purpose applications.
Q2: How do you customize a micro vibration motor to meet low acoustic noise requirements in quiet environments?
Lowering acoustic noise (measured in dB) involves optimization of the internal rotor balancing, using high-purity commutators, and selecting precious metal brush materials (such as silver or gold alloys) instead of carbon brushes. Additionally, integrating rubber boots or silicone sleeves around the motor casing isolates mechanical structure-borne noise, preventing it from resonating against the device's outer plastic shell.
Q3: Why are coreless (hollow cup) motor designs preferred for high-performance applications?
Coreless DC motors eliminate the iron core from the rotor winding structure, resulting in a significantly lower moment of inertia. This reduction allows for rapid acceleration and deceleration, making them highly responsive. They do not experience iron loss (cogging), which yields smooth rotation, higher overall efficiency, and a longer operational lifespan under fast-cycling haptic duty cycles.
Q4: What environmental protection ratings can be applied to micro vibration motors?
For devices exposed to moisture or particulate contamination, we can manufacture micro motors within completely enclosed housings or apply protective potting compounds over the terminal connections. In specialized applications, hermetically sealed coin motors or capsule vibration motors are used to achieve ingress protection ratings up to IP67, protecting internal coils and commutator segments from chemical washdowns or dust.
